What are you guys using for incubators?  Do any of you use a commercial one?  I have heard that ones that they sell at stores aren't very good and end up costing a lot with additional pieces.  Thoughts?

I have 2 styrofoam bators. My DH bought them for me, when him and I didnt have a clue which bator to buy, and we didn't research. But they work well, I use both of them. I have figured out the dynamics. one is circ air and the other is still air. If i use the still air for incubating I put a folded up towel under the back end to elevate the eggs, about a 10-15 degree slant. the circ air incubator has an egg turner, so i dont need to elevate/slant the bator.
The circ air bator is a Little Giant (LG) 11300. The still air is made by Farm Inovators (FI) 2100 **one thing I do not like about the still air, the heating element is a tube that hang from the inside of the lid. and when the chicks or ducklings, etc hatch and when they start sitting up and stretching and walking around, they hit thier head or beak on the HOT heating element. I accidently touched it when I was reaching in and I still have a burn scar.... poor little babies. I have seen one duck and chick touch it and jump back, but I never saw a burn mark on them, curiously?? and I cant raise the lid or lower the floor.
700

One thing I would like to say about the circ air bator... it has a wire that comes from the lid and hangs inside the bator: at the end of the wire is an "L" probe that regulates the temperature (i thought it was the hygrometer gage). I find that if I place the probe Directly under the fan (in the middle of the bator) the temp is very stable. Since doing this i have not had anymore temp spikes...
